Dear Maintainer, *** Reporter, please consider answering these questions, where appropriate *** * What led up to the situation? * What exactly did you do (or not do) that was effective (or ineffective)? * What was the outcome of this action? * What outcome did you expect instead? *** End of the template - remove these template lines *** The program that this package packages doesn't work 100% of the time, and fails with an error about prime-select not existing when you try to use it any way. It suggests the nvidia-prime package, which is required for it to work, however nvidia-prime isn't packaged for Debian, only for Ubuntu. (Also, there is an unresolved open wishlist item/similar to package nvidia-prime). And the Ubuntu specific nvidia-prime package provides the required prime-select tool.
